Historical Context: More Than Just Rivalry Games

While today’s matchup feels urgent, it exists within a broader historical framework. The Yankees and Rays have met numerous times since Tampa Bay’s inception in 1998, but their rivalry intensified after the Rays became the first Wild Card team to win a World Series in 2008. That victory not only shocked the baseball world but also redefined what underdog teams could achieve through smart management and player development.

Over the past decade, the Yankees have often viewed the Rays as both competitors and cautionary tales—reminding them that even teams without superstar salaries can outmaneuver wealthier clubs. Conversely, the Rays respect the Yankees’ legacy but aren’t intimidated by the brand recognition or financial muscle.

Historically, head-to-head matchups between these teams have been close, with the Rays holding a slight edge in recent years thanks to superior run prevention and bullpen depth. However, when the Yankees are healthy and Cole is firing on all cylinders, they’ve historically dominated at Yankee Stadium.
